[Debian-med-packaging] Java problem when upgrading pixelmed

Andreas Tille andreas at an3as.eu
Tue Oct 6 20:28:09 UTC 2015


Hi,

I tried to upgrade pixelmed[1] to the latest version (20150917 as per
trunk in SVN) but the build failed with

export JAVAVERSIONTARGETJARFILE=/usr/lib/jvm/default-java/jre/lib/rt.jar; javac -O -target 1.7 -source 1.7 -bootclasspath ${JAVAVERSIONTARGETJARFILE} -encoding "UTF8" -Xlint:           deprecation -XDignore.symbol.file \
        -classpath ../../..:/usr/share/java/commons-compress.jar:/usr/share/java/commons-codec.jar:/usr/share/java/vecmath.jar:/usr/share/java/jai_imageio.jar:/usr/share/java/          pixelmed_codec.jar \
        -sourcepath ../../.. ImageEditUtilities.java
ImageEditUtilities.java:119: error: package com.pixelmed.codec.jpeg does not exist
                                                com.pixelmed.codec.jpeg.Parse.parse(fbis,fbos,shapes);
                                                                       ^
1 error
Makefile:66: recipe for target 'ImageEditUtilities.class' failed

Any help how to solve this would be appreciated.  I tried to address
this by debian/patches/imageio.patch

--- a/com/pixelmed/display/ImageEditUtilities.java
+++ b/com/pixelmed/display/ImageEditUtilities.java
@@ -26,6 +26,7 @@ import java.io.File;
 import java.io.FileNotFoundException;
 import java.io.FileOutputStream;
 import java.io.IOException;
+import javax.imageio.*;

 import java.util.Iterator;
 import java.util.Vector;


but this does not have any effect.

Kind regards

     Andreas.

[1] svn://anonscm.debian.org/debian-med/trunk/packages/pixelmed/trunk/

-- 
http://fam-tille.de



More information about the Debian-med-packaging mailing list